Overview & Features
Create a sign using the correct format to create a mob spawner! You can hide these signs under floors, to create dungeons, arenas, etc! Obviously with permission, players can create spawners for their own use, toggle the spawner on/off at their own leisure (just right-click the sign!), and the sign will automatically stop spawning mobs if a player is not in a 20 block radius.
So this plugin serves as a sign mob spawner type thing. You can use it for creating mob arenas, mob grinders, zoos, and whatever else you want to do. There's still a lot to do, and you can check all that out in the todo list. Also, suggest stuff for me to do, that helps.
So far, they function as sign psuedo mob spawners, but in the future I'll make it so you can configure the XP, item drops, and display names for the entities that spawn.

Usage
First, you must be an OP or have the permission to create and destroy MobSigns. You should format your list as follows:
[MobSign] - (You must head your sign with this for the plugin to recognize your sign)
EntityType - (Provide the entity type for the mob you would like to spawn)
Amount - (How many you want to spawn at each wave)
